Stability in Times of Change

We understand that to perform quality work, a person needs a reliable foundation. Working on tasks that change the rules of the game on the front lines, our team needs to be confident in their tomorrow.

That is why Pegasus Arms offers transparent and dignified terms of cooperation:

  1. Official employment and transparent salary. We respect the law and the labor of our people, guaranteeing fair financial compensation.
  2. Employee reservation (Deferment). As an enterprise critical to the country's defense capability, we ensure reservation (deferment from military service) for our key team members.
  3. Health and well-being. Full coverage of sick leave and a guaranteed 24 calendar days of vacation. We know that to work effectively, one must rest effectively.
  4. Comfort and development. We create conditions where you want to create, and we support our employees' drive for learning.

In conversations about the front line, we often hear the word "drone." Volunteers "buy drones," and the news shows "drone work." However, in professional military documentation and invoices, the abbreviations UAV and UAS appear much more frequently.

What are UAV and UAS, and is there a difference between a Unmanned Aerial Vehicle (UAV) and an Unmanned Aerial System (UAS)?

Yes, and it is significant. It is the difference between simple "hardware" and a full-fledged combat system.

Today, we explain this difference using our flagship—the Pegasus Arms 25—as an example.
